Why QuickBooks Error 6150 occurs?

  • “QBW” or company file is damaged. You need to create a “Portable backup file.”
  • A damaged or corrupt QuickBooks installation
  • You are trying to open a portable file (.qbm) without opening QuickBooks.
  • A changed or wrongly typed extension for QuickBooks file.
  • Trying to save “QuickBooks Macintosh file” while using QuickBooks for Windows.
  • The company file is infected with the virus.

Method 1- You require to restore from Backup:
If the above method has been pointless in resolving QuickBooks Error Codes 6150, the next best
the move is to restore from backup the "Company file." Let us look at the same steps:

  • Navigate to QuickBooks
  • Click File
  • Select” Open or Restore Company
  • Choose to “Restore a backup copy” & click “”
  • Select “local backup” & click “”
  • Choose the location of “ company file backup” from the “Look-In” drop-down list
  • Click “the backup,” and it should be available with a “.qbb” extension
  • Press “Open” and then click “”
  • Now go to “Save in” drop-down window & browse to the desired location to restore the backup file.
  • In the “File-name” field- type/enter a “new company ”
  • Check that the “save as filed” should have been automatically saved to restore the file in the “.qbw” format.
  • Select “Yes”
  • Now type “Yes” to confirm the overwrite process.
